1.- THE DECIMAL NUMERAL SYSTEM. HOW TO WRITE NUMBERS

Nuestro sistema de numeración es DECIMAL Y POSICIONAL:

DECIMAL porque se compone de diez símbolos: 0, 1, 2, 3, ……… y diez unidades del mismo orden forman una unidad del orden superior.

1 decena = 10 unidades

1 centena = 10 decenas = 100 unidades

1 unidad de millar = 10 centenas = ……. = 1000 unidades

1 decena de millar = 10 unidades de millar = ……… = 10.000 unidades

1 centena de millar = 10 decenas de millar = ……… = 100.000 unidades

1 unidad de millón = 10 centenas de millar = ……. = 1.000.000 unidades

POSICIONAL porque el valor de cada símbolo depende de la posición en el número.

In English, the names of the place values are:

1 ten = 10 units

1 hundred = 10 tens = 100 units

1 thousand = 10 hundreds = ……. = 1000 units

1 ten-thousands = 10 thousands = ……… = 10.000 units

1 hundred-thousands = 10 ten-thousands = ……… = 100.000 units

1 million = 10 hundred-thousands = ……. = 1.000.000 units
